About Polyspin Exports Ltd (POLYSPIN)
Polyspin Exports Ltd operates in the Packaging industry, within the Capital Goods sector. It trades on the NSE as POLYSPIN and on the BSE under scrip code 539354. Its ISIN is INE914G01029.
Incorporated in 1972, Polyspin Exports Ltd primarily manufactures and exports FIBC bags [1]
Polyspin Exports Limited, established in 1985, manufactures a range of products, including FIBC bags, OE yarn, and PP yarn, with a strong focus on exports.
The company is a 100% Export-Oriented Unit, primarily shipping its FIBC bags to markets in the USA, Europe, and Africa.

Financial Performance
Mar 2026In the year ended Mar 2026, Polyspin Exports Ltd (POLYSPIN) reported revenue of ₹226 crore, net profit of ₹6 crore and earnings per share of ₹5.56. That compares with revenue of ₹225 crore and net profit of ₹4 crore in Mar 2025. Figures are consolidated, as filed with the exchanges.
In the quarter ended Mar 2026, revenue was ₹55.73 crore and net profit ₹0.49 crore (consolidated).
| Metric | Mar 2022 | Mar 2023 | Mar 2024 | Mar 2025 | Mar 2026 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ue (₹ cr) | 277 | 208 | 202 | 225 | 226 |
| Net profit (₹ cr) | 9 | 5 | -3 | 4 | 6 |
| EPS (₹) | 9.22 | 5.37 | -2.78 | 4.1 | 5.56 |
